PCI: vmd: Fix inconsistent indentation in vmd_resume()
The if-statement within the vmd_resume() function has an inconsistent
indentation that leads to a compile time warning.
Thus, correct the inconsistent indentation. While at it, remove the
if-statement completely, which will make the code simpler.
This was detected by Smatch:
drivers/pci/controller/vmd.c:1066 vmd_resume() warn: inconsistent indenting
No functional changes are intended.
